Differential equations are mathematical equations that relate a function with its derivatives. They are widely used in physics, engineering, biology, and other fields to model various phenomena. Differential equations can be classified into different
types, such as linear, nonlinear, ordinary, partial, homogeneous, inhomogeneous, etc.

Differential equations are not only useful for describing natural phenomena, but also for solving practical problems. For example, differential equations can be used to model the motion of a pendulum, the growth of a population, the spread of a disease,
the decay of a radioactive substance, the flow of heat, the vibration of a string, and many more.
To solve a differential equation, you need to find a function that satisfies the equation and its initial or boundary conditions. There are different methods for solving different types of differential equations, such as separation of variables,
integration factors, variation of parameters, undetermined coefficients, series solutions, Laplace transforms, Fourier series, etc.
